Victorian Sash Windows

Classically designed, a Victorian sash window is a double-hung window. By sliding the bottom half up or down, and keeping the top half stationary, the frame can be opened or closed. The Victorian sash is very traditional, and still make up one of the most common styles of windows today.

Typically there will be a large gap between the bottom edge of the sash and the frame – this is called the reveal, and it naturally creates space that would allow cold air to enter through the frame.  In addition to the classic look, ornate crowns and returns can be added at the top and bottom. Do I need planning permission?

If replacing sash windows, planning permission might be required. A Conservation Officer or local planning department can help you work out if planning permission will be needed.  For smooth project execution, make sure you contact us before making any decisions.
